Kenneth Bostrom is 56 years old (2001) and lives in Helsingborg in south of Sweden.  He is one the most famous fly fishers, fly tyers in Sweden.  The below introduction is in his words...

 

For almost 40 years I've been passionately involved in fly fishing and traveled widely, fishing famous and little known waters all over the world.  During this time I've been able to test new ideas and techniques in regard to fishing tactics, equipment and strategies.

 

It's been my privilege to be closely involved in the development of fly fishing in the Nordic countries and I've been especially interested in developing modern fly imitations such as my successful "Rackelhanen" caddis imitation.  I've produced two books on the insects life to be found in and around our Scandinavian streams, "Dagslandor i oringvatten" (Mayflies in trout waters) and "Nattslandor i oringvatten" (Caddis in trout waters).  In 1998 I published my book on rod building, "Spöbyggnad på mitt sätt" (Rodbuilding, my way).

 

During the 70s I started to experiment with split cane rods, adding upper sections in graphite.  I was trying to combine the best of both materials, to create the "perfect" rod action.  At that time I couldn't imagine how far this technique would develop, or how fast.  All this experimenting resulted in my own rod creation: the Rackelhanen rod.   I think that they really do combine the best of both world and offer unique action.
